Short-form video is no longer just for entertainment—it’s one of the most powerful marketing tools in 2025. Platforms like Instagram Reels, YouTube Shorts, and TikTok are reshaping how consumers interact with brands.
The Shift in User Behavior
Today’s user attention span is less than 8 seconds. That’s where short-form video thrives—grabbing attention quickly, creating emotional connections, and delivering brand value in under 60 seconds.
Why Struggling Brands Are Turning to Reels
When traditional posts (like static images or blogs) fail to get reach or engagement, brands are switching to:
Behind-the-scenes clips
Customer testimonials in video
Product demos in story format
Educational 15-30 second tips
These formats are not just easy to consume—they’re highly shareable and great for virality.
2025 Trends to Watch
AI-Generated Video Editing Tools (e.g., captions, background music)
Shoppable Reels: Seamless product links inside videos
Voice-over and storytelling formats are driving emotional connection

Tips for Fresh Brands
Post consistently (3–5 reels/week)
Follow trends but personalize them
Always add a clear CTA (Comment, Save, Buy)
Use hashtags strategically (5–10, niche and trending)
